我正在运行 this shell script作为 OSX 中的应用程序,使用新的个人文件夹启动多个 Chrome 实例:
do shell script "/Applications/Google\\ Chrome.app/Contents/MacOS/Google\\ Chrome --enable-udd-profiles --user-data-dir=/Users/$USER/Library/Application\\ Support/Google/ChromePersonal > /dev/null 2>&1 &"
这太棒了——因为我可以在 Chrome 实例之间进行 CMD-TAB 而不清除 cookie/缓存等。
问题:我想扩展脚本以在 Dock 和 CMD-TAB 弹出窗口中的每个实例的 Chrome 图标上覆盖一个大的“2”、“3”等,以便我可以区分实例。现在,我看到的只是多个 Chrome.app 图标。
关于如何做到这一点的任何想法?我也愿意编辑图标,但是 Chrome2.app 图标不会影响 Dock 图标 - 因为 Dock 图标来自原始 Chrome.app。
更新:问题已解决,方法如下:
最佳答案
我在 http://blog.duoconsulting.com/2011/03/13/multiple-profiles-in-google-chrome-for-os-x/ 使用脚本,它会在 Applications 文件夹中为您创建新的 Chrome 应用程序,并绑定(bind)到特定的配置文件。
之后,您可以简单地获取信息并将 PNG 粘贴为您的图标。我为每个 Chrome 实例使用不同颜色的 Chrome 图标和主题。
关于google-chrome - 管理多个 Chrome 配置文件 - OSX,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5451439/